CLEANING
CLEANING ENGINE COMPARTMENT
Before cleaning the engine compartment, place a strip of tape over the magneto vents
to prevent any solvent from entering these units.
a.
Place a large pan under the engine to catch waste.
b.
With the engine cowling removed, spray or brush the engine with solvent or a
mixture of solvent and degreaser. In order to remove especially heavy dirt and
grease deposits, it may be necessary to brush areas that were sprayed.
CAUTION
Do not spray solvent into the alternator, vacuum pump, statter,
or air intakes.
c.
Allow the solvent to remain on the engine from five to ten minutes. Then rinse
the engine clean with additional solvent and allow it to dry.
CAUTION
Do not operate the engine until excess solvent has evaporated or
otherwise been removed.
d.
Remove the protective tape from the magnetos.
e.
Lubricate the controls, bearing surfaces, etc., in accordance with the Lubrication
Chart.
CLEANING LANDING GEAR
Before cleaning the landing gear, place a cover of plastic or a similar waterproof
material over the wheel and brake assembly.
a.
Place a pan under the gear to catch waste.
b.
Spray or brush the gear area with solvent or a mixture of solvent and degreaser.
In order to remove especially heavy dirt and grease deposits, it may be necessary
to brush areas that were sprayed.
c.
Allow the solvent to remain on the gear from five to ten minutes. Then rinse the
gear with additional solvent and allow it to dry.
d.
Remove the cover from the wheel and remove the catch pan.
e.
Lubricate the gear in accordance with the Lubrication Chart.
